Position Leasing Manager Reports to Community Manager:

POSITION SUMMARY: 

The Leasing Manager assists the Community Manager in overseeing the day-to-day operations of an apartment community and performs a variety of duties. The Leasing Manager also oversees the leasing staff and may interact directly with prospective and current residents to achieve maximum occupancy, acts as the Company’s representative by conveying the benefits of the Community, is responsible for the leasing process from introduction to the actual occupancy of the resident, and maintains communication throughout the tenancy of the resident. 

JOB SPECIFIC COMPETENCIES: 

  • Oversee the marketing and advertising of vacancies to attract potential residents 
  • Scout and identify prospective residents looking to lease a property
  • Provide potential residents with a tour of the property or home highlighting the valuable features of the building to convince customers and influence lease 
  • Run background checks on potential residents to evaluate their credit status and criminal records to determine if they are eligible to occupy an apartment 
  • Oversee the processing and approval of resident applications and lease documents
  • Elaborate on the terms of the lease, rental rate, and period of payment to the resident 
  • Guide the activities and operations of a leasing team to ensure revenue goals are achieved
  • Organize meetings during which leasing operations are discussed to identify solutions necessary for achieving occupancy targets 
  • Oversee the hiring and on-the-job training of leasing recruits to bring them up-to-speed on work activities
  • Conduct a survey of the property market to obtain information on competing lease rates and other trends that affect occupancy/rent
  • Supervise campaign activities for the publicity of properties available for lease 
  • Ensure the proper documentation and storage of leasing files
  • Develop and implement policies necessary for improving the profitability and efficiency of a leasing department
  • Inspect the leasing path and model at the beginning of each business day and prepare work orders if anything needs correcting
  • First point of resident contact for work orders and resident issues
